Summary
In this episode of Brydon&, Rob is joined by actor Luke Thompson to talk about his current role in the emotionally-charged play "A Little Life," with James Norton. Their conversation spans Luke's upbringing in France, his introduction to the world of acting, and how he landed the exciting role in hit series "Bridgerton."
